Abstract
Abstract
The abstract describing the content of the publication or report
Abstract:
A programme of archaeological evaluation was undertaken on land to the north of Tilgate Dam, Tilgate, Crawley, West Sussex, in advance of a proposed raiding of the height of the dam and associated works. The work was undertaken between the 23rd and 25th of February 2010 on behalf of Jacobs and the Environmental Agency. Five evaluation trenches measuring between 5 and 8.5 metres in length sampled the archaeology across the site. The natural horizon varied in depth from 85.144m OD in the east of the site and 86.560m OD in the west of the site. The remains of several post-medieval buildings were uncovered as shown on the 1st edition OS map. The remains relate to the Lower Tilgate House and an earlier 16th phase of construction (Trench 1 and 2) and two possible mill buildings (Trench 4 and 5).
